Causes of Brown Spots
π§ Overwatering and Its Effects
Overwatering is a common issue that can lead to brown spots on your plant's leaves. Symptoms include yellowing leaves, mushy stems, and, of course, those pesky brown spots.
To identify overwatering, check the soil moisture levels and look for drainage issues. If the soil feels soggy or retains water for too long, it can severely impact root health, leading to root rot and other complications.
π° Under-watering and Its Effects
On the flip side, under-watering can also cause brown spots. Symptoms typically manifest as dry, crispy leaves and brown tips.
To determine if your plant is under-watered, assess the soil dryness and observe for wilting leaves. Long-term effects of insufficient watering include stunted growth and leaf drop, which can be detrimental to your plant's overall health.
π₯¦ Nutrient Deficiencies
Nitrogen Deficiency
A nitrogen deficiency can present itself through yellowing leaves accompanied by brown spots. Nitrogen is crucial for foliage health, as it promotes lush, green growth.
Potassium Deficiency
Potassium deficiency often shows up as browning leaf edges and spots. This nutrient plays a vital role in overall plant vigor, affecting everything from growth to disease resistance.
π Pest Infestations
Spider Mites
Spider mites are notorious for causing damage to plants, and their signs of infestation include webbing and stippled leaves. They can lead to brown spots and even leaf drop if not addressed promptly.
Aphids
Aphids can also wreak havoc on your plants, leaving behind sticky residue and curled leaves. Their feeding habits deplete nutrients, resulting in brown spots and weakened plants.
π Fungal Infections
Leaf Spot Fungus
Leaf spot fungus manifests as dark brown spots with yellow halos around them. Conditions that promote this fungal growth include high humidity and poor air circulation, making it essential to monitor your plant's environment closely.

Diagnosing the Problem
Assessing Watering Habits π
Evaluating your watering schedule is crucial for maintaining healthy plants. Start by observing how often you water and adjust based on the specific needs of your plant.
Look for signs of overwatering, such as yellowing leaves and mushy stems, versus underwatering, which typically presents as dry, crispy leaves. Understanding these symptoms can help you strike the right balance.
Evaluating Soil Quality and Drainage ποΈ
Well-draining soil is essential for preventing root rot and promoting healthy growth. Poor drainage can lead to waterlogged roots, causing brown spots on leaves.
To check soil drainage, perform a simple water retention test. Pour water into the soil and observe how quickly it absorbs; if it pools on the surface, drainage issues are likely.
Checking for Pests π
Regular inspections are key to early pest detection. Look for signs of infestations, such as webbing from spider mites or sticky residue from aphids.
Utilize tools like magnifying glasses or sticky traps to identify pests effectively. Early intervention can save your plants from serious damage.
Analyzing Environmental Conditions π€οΈ
Assessing light exposure is vital for leaf health. Ensure your plants receive the right amount of light, as too much or too little can lead to brown spots.
Additionally, monitor temperature and humidity levels. Fluctuations can stress your plants, making them more susceptible to issues like pests and diseases.

Treatment Options
π Immediate Actions to Take
Adjusting Watering Schedule
- Determine current watering frequency: Start by observing how often you water your plant.
- Adjust based on plant needs: Most plants thrive with watering every 1-2 weeks, but this can vary.
- Use moisture meter for accuracy: A moisture meter can help you gauge soil moisture levels, ensuring you avoid over or under-watering.
Treating Nutrient Deficiencies
- Recommended fertilizers: Use balanced NPK (Nitrogen, Phosphorus, Potassium) fertilizers to address deficiencies.
- Application frequency: Fertilize every 4-6 weeks during the growing season to keep your plants nourished.
Pest Control Methods
- Organic options: Consider using neem oil or insecticidal soap for a gentle yet effective approach to pest control.
- Chemical options: If pests persist, targeted pesticides can be used to tackle specific infestations.
Fungicide Application
- Types of fungicides: Choose between systemic fungicides, which work from within the plant, and contact fungicides that target surface infections.
- Application timing: Apply fungicides at the first sign of fungal infection to prevent further damage.
π Long-term Care Strategies
Improving Soil Health
- Recommended soil amendments: Incorporate compost and perlite to enhance soil structure and nutrient content.
- Importance of regular soil testing: Regular testing helps you understand your soil's needs and adjust accordingly.
Regular Monitoring for Pests and Diseases
- Setting up a routine inspection schedule: Regular checks can catch issues before they escalate.
- Keeping a plant care journal: Documenting changes helps track plant health and identify patterns over time.
Adjusting Light and Humidity Levels
- Ideal light conditions: Ensure your plants receive the right amount of light for their specific needs.
- Methods to increase humidity: Use pebble trays or humidifiers to create a more favorable environment for your plants.

Preventive Measures
Best Practices for Watering π
Proper watering is crucial for healthy plants. To avoid overwatering, ensure the top inch of soil is dry before adding more water.
Look for signs like yellowing leaves or wilting to prevent underwatering. A consistent watering schedule tailored to your plant's needs can make all the difference.
Fertilization Tips π±
A balanced fertilization schedule is key to vibrant foliage. Aim to fertilize every 4-6 weeks during the growing season to provide essential nutrients.
Use fertilizers with balanced NPK ratios to support overall plant health. Organic options can also enhance soil quality while feeding your plants.
Creating an Optimal Growing Environment π‘οΈ
Maintaining ideal temperature and humidity levels is vital for plant vitality. Most houseplants thrive in temperatures between 65Β°F and 75Β°F, with humidity levels around 40-60%.
Air circulation and proper light exposure are equally important. Ensure your plants receive adequate light without being scorched by direct sun.
Regular Maintenance and Inspection Routines π
Establishing a maintenance schedule helps catch issues before they escalate. Regular inspections can reveal early signs of pests or diseases.
Keeping a plant care journal is a great way to track changes and interventions. Early detection leads to effective solutions, keeping your plants healthy and thriving.
